H&M Landing in San Diego is one of Southern California’s premier sportfishing destinations, offering a wide range of fishing opportunities from local inshore trips to multi-day offshore adventures. With access to some of the most productive waters in the region, H&M Landing provides anglers with the chance to target species like Yellowtail, Bluefin Tuna, Rockfish, and Dorado.

Point Loma Sportfishing, located in San Diego, is one of the premier sportfishing landings on the West Coast. With daily departures from their diverse fleet of boats, anglers have access to inshore and offshore trips targeting popular species such as Bluefin Tuna, Yellowtail, Rockfish, Calico Bass, and more. Whether you’re planning a half-day trip or a multi-day offshore adventure, Point Loma Sportfishing offers opportunities for both novice and seasoned anglers.

Fisherman’s Landing, located in San Diego’s bustling sportfishing district, is renowned for providing top-tier fishing adventures. Whether you’re chasing Bluefin Tuna, Yellowtail, Dorado, or other prized species, Fisherman’s Landing offers anglers a variety of trips tailored for both beginners and experts. Their long-range and multi-day trips are among the best in the sportfishing industry, taking anglers far offshore to fish in some of the most productive waters on the West Coast.

Seaforth Landing, located in San Diego, is one of the top sportfishing landings in Southern California. Offering a wide variety of trips, Seaforth Landing provides opportunities for anglers to target species like Yellowtail, Bluefin Tuna, Dorado, Rockfish, and more. Whether you’re interested in a half-day coastal trip or a multi-day offshore adventure, Seaforth Landing has options for both beginners and seasoned anglers.
